Insider purchase reported: A Form 4 shows director Charles M. Elson acquired 2,344 shares of Enhabit, Inc. (EHAB) on 10/10/2025 at a price of $8 per share. After the transaction he beneficially owns 77,417 shares. The filing was signed by an attorney-in-fact on 10/10/2025. The report lists the transaction as a direct acquisition by the reporting person.
